Transaction 621bdfbdd08b8a455525201b6937a33c9018eac31a90bfb32ebe4fa396a4bfba
1 Input
1 Output
-
621bdfbdd08b8a455525201b6937a33c9018eac31a90bfb32ebe4fa396a4bfba: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f8ac606e2de72c3c33ce2fcdd1bb8acad7dcfdfb088cb5018178aadd574aabac
- address
- bc1plzkxqm3duukrcv7w9lxarwu2ettael0mpzxt2qvp0z4d64624wkqc2qlkq